The Fox Theatre Boulder, Co, US (Nov/14/1993)

From: Gavin Murphy/Michael Murphy

I am reviewing this with recollections from the phone conversation I had with my brother who saw the show there in 1993. I know that the Fox is an old movie theatre in downtown Boulder that has been converted into a club. The show was on a Sunday night and it was snowing that night so the turn out was fairly low , about 80 to 100 people. They played a standard Storm in Heaven tour set and despite the low turn out performed a killer show. They went on around 11:30 pm (sunday) and right at midnight they played Make It Til' Monday which was cool. Most shows from this tour were not "sold out" affairs, but they were on their first tour of America and musically were stellar every night.
